(1) Pursuant to Rule 416(a) under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”), this Registration Statement on Form S-8 also covers any additional shares of WPX Energy, Inc. Common Stock in respect of the securities identified in the above table as a result of any stock dividend, stock split, recapitalization or other similar transaction. The securities to be registered include options and rights to acquire Common Stock.
(2) Estimated solely for the purpose of calculating the registration fee. This registration fee has been calculated pursuant to Rule 457(c) and 457(h)(1) of the Securities Act based upon the average of the high and low prices of WPX Energy, Inc. Common Stock on May 15, 2013, as reported by the New York Stock Exchange.
(3) 5,648,211 of the 15,467,118 shares being registered under the WPX Energy, Inc. 2013 Incentive Plan represent shares previously registered by WPX Energy, Inc. (the “Registrant”) under the WPX Energy, Inc. 2011 Incentive Plan on Form S-8, registration statement no. 333-178388, filed on December 9, 2011 for which the Registrant paid a filing fee of $19,703 (the “Prior Registration Statement”). The Registrant has filed a post-effective amendment to deregister such shares from the Prior Registration Statement filed with respect to the predecessor plan, and accordingly, the associated registration fee previously paid on these shares under the Prior Registration Statement is being carried forward to offset the registration fee under this registration statement. The entire filing fee for the Prior Registration Statement was offset with the filing fee previously paid for registration statement no. 333-173808 on Form S-1 filed on April 29, 2011, which was withdrawn prior to becoming effective. As a result, the $38,123 registration fee that would be due on a proposed maximum aggregate offering price of $279,490,822 has been reduced by $19,703 to $18,419.

Item 6. Indemnification of Directors and Officers.

Our amended and restated certificate of incorporation provides that a director will not be liable to the corporation or its stockholders for monetary damages for breach of fiduciary duty as a director to the fullest extent that the Delaware General Corporation Law (“DGCL”) or any other law of the State of Delaware permits. If the DGCL or any other law of the State of Delaware is amended to authorize the further elimination or limitation of the liability of directors, then the liability of a director will be limited to the fullest extent permitted by the amended DGCL or other law, as applicable.

We are empowered by Section 145 of the DGCL, subject to the procedures and limitations stated therein, to indemnify any person against expenses (including attorneys’ fees), judgments, fines, and amounts paid in settlement actually and reasonably incurred by them in connection with any threatened, pending, or completed action, suit, or proceeding in which such person is made party by reason of their being or having been a director, officer, employee, or agent of the Company. The statute provides that indemnification pursuant to its provisions is not exclusive of other rights of indemnification to which a person may be entitled under any bylaw, agreement, vote of stockholders or disinterested directors, or otherwise. Our bylaws provide for indemnification by us of our directors and officers to the fullest extent permitted by the DGCL.


The Company maintains, policies of insurance under which our directors and officers are insured, within the limits and subject to the limitations of the policies, against certain expenses in connection with the defense of actions, suits, or proceedings, and certain liabilities which might be imposed as a result of such actions, suits or proceedings, to which they are parties by reason of being or having been such directors or officers.
